一張圖告訴你為什麼是服務網關,文末有現金抽獎。

java那些事2019-01-11 21:25:44

點擊上方藍色文字關注↑↑↑↑↑

網關服務是單一訪問點,並充當多項服務的代理。服務網關啟用了跨所有服務的路由轉發、過濾和公共處理等。

在微服務實踐中遠不止這點功能,它可以做到統一接入、流量管控、安全防護、業務隔離等功能。

下面是服務網關的大概作用圖。

看完這張圖,或許你已經明白了服務網關的作用,及使用服務網關帶來的諸多好處。

所以,既然服務網關有這麼多作用,也是現在微服務套件中的必用組件,你還有什麼理由不用服務網關呢?

下圖是使用了Spring Cloud的服務網關的套件圖。

Spring Cloud使用了Zuul作為服務網關組件,圖中Open Service即是服務網關,Service A,B是內部實際的業務服務,通過Open Service對外進行內部服務的請求的路由、過濾等操作。


週末愉快,公眾號不定期推出現金紅包抽獎。

本次獎品6.66元X3紅包,滿666人自動開獎。請長按下圖參加,並在文章下方留言提出對服務網關的看法,開獎後未留言或臨時留言的得獎無效。開獎後,請在公眾號回覆得獎截圖與微信二維碼,管理員會取得聯繫發送紅包。

3天內未滿666人蔘與,將會自動自廢,請大家轉發朋友圈。

如果對你有用,歡迎分享到朋友圈

資料

《免費領取架構師四階段資料》

dubbo使用及源碼解析教程

推薦

分佈式ID生成器方案總結

史上最全多線程面試題及答案


Java技術棧

長按二維碼關注我們



架構|分佈式|技術教程|面經


閱讀原文